11212 vs 77095

Side-by-side comparison (2022 Census data).

Metric1121277095
StateNew YorkTexas
Population84,00669,644
Median Income$35,840$90,690
Median Home Value$565,200$269,100
Median Rent$1,150$1,479
Median Age37.238.9
Poverty Rate32.9%5.1%
Bachelor's Degree+15.7%40.2%
Homeownership14.4%70.7%
Unemployment14.2%5.9%
